Actual Rating: 3.5 stars

I thought the book started out very well at first and I was super intrigued at how The Arc would find a match for Ursula. Ursula was definitely an interesting character and I understand she was meant to be written as this quirky person but her personality did feel over the top at times. I did enjoy the pacing of the book and didn't think it was too slow or fast. The development of Ursula's and Rafael's relationship was fairly interesting to read although a bit too lovey-dovey at times.

However, as the book carried on, I felt that at some points, Hoen elaborated too much on some details and created scenarios that didn't feel like they were necessary. There was a lot of elements surrounding Ursula's life (her job, her mom, her friends, The Stake, her work with Mike etc.) and I felt that it sometimes pulled my attention away from the main plot rather than supported it. And afterwards, I am left a bit disinterested in what's next.

Overall, it was a quick read and I was pretty invested in Ursula's and Rafael's relationship but wished that The Arc focused on that storyline more.
